Youngstown Real Estate Market

As of June 2026, the median home listed in Youngstown, OH asks $199,950 — down 5.9% year over year. Homes sell in a median of 42 days, with 764 active listings and 18% carrying a price cut — a seller-leaning market. Figures come from public records and industry data, updated monthly.

How have home prices changed in Youngstown?

Youngstown home prices are down 5.9% year over year and +0.5% month over month as of June 2026, at a $199,950 median listing price. The chart tracks the trailing eight-quarter trend in the metro's median asking price.

How much inventory is on the market in Youngstown?

Youngstown has 764 active listings, 588 new this month, 661 pending as of June 2026. About 18% of active listings have cut their price, and inventory sits at 62% of its 2019 level — a seller-leaning market by pace.

Youngstown scores 63/100 on our composite Investor Score (#203 of 932 covered metros), a percentile blend of momentum, value, rental yield, supply and market-heat readings; the metro's long-run house price index has it up 60% over five years and +103% over ten, leaving prices 90% above its own 2000–2019 trend; at the published FY2026 fair market rent of $973/mo for a two-bedroom, the gross rental yield on the median listing is about 5.8%; active inventory sits at 62% of its June 2019 level, so supply is still below pre-pandemic norms; listing prices are down 5.9% year over year; all against a national 30-year fixed mortgage rate of 6.43% (national weekly average, 2026-07-02).

How much is a monthly mortgage payment in Youngstown?

A home at Youngstown's $199,950 median listing runs about $1,004 a month in principal and interest — 20% down on a 30-year fixed loan at the current 6.43% national average rate. Taxes, insurance and HOA are extra.

What is driving the Youngstown housing market?

Longer-run demand in Youngstown shows up in 284 homes permitted in 2025; net migration of +462 residents; -0.4% job growth. Natural-hazard risk rates Relatively Moderate. These federal supply-pipeline, migration and jobs signals shape where prices head next.
